Letter: The inequities of west side vs. east side in the Salt Lake Valley are even evident on the sidewalks after a snowstorm, writes Stephen in Salt Lake City.

To reach the pedestrian bridge over the highway, I struggled over more icy mounds. And then precisely at the apex of the bridge above the roar of the interstate, my path became clear, shoveled and salted, leading me safely down toward the TRAX station.

The inequities of westside vs. eastside in the Salt Lake Valley could not have been more clear— mapped in the snow. We hear endless pledges to do better, to pay more attention to our westside communities. In 2022, let’s match our words with action.
